🥩 Yakiniku Rikimaru Shop 🥩

Ikebukuro sta. (East Exit, FLC building, 5th floor. There is an AOKI sign near Dongy.)

All-you-can-saturate buffet grilled meat shop starting 3,498 yen (7xx baht) 💰

There are 3 Buffet options, Standard, Premium and Wagyu.

Available in 70, 90 and 120 minutes. ⏰

We chose Wagyu 120 minutes (5,808 yen inc.vat) Max. There is a lot of meat. 🥢 Wagyu 🥩 Pork 🥓 side dishes with a lot of toys. Yuke and Peabimbab Cheese are recommended (a Japanese shop that makes Korean peabimbab very delicious. Confused). At the store there are soft drink and alcohol refills. This is a great love shop. This is repeated in Osaka 2 times and is very addictive to cow tongue and seafood. This time to Tokyo. Unfortunately, there is no seafood menu (1 star deducted).
